Why Traditional Network Security Approaches Are Limited
Traditional security tools remain essential components of cybersecurity strategies. However, they may not provide the complete visibility needed for modern ICT environments.
Traditional Security Approach | Challenge in ICT Environments |
Firewall-based protection | Limited insight beyond network boundaries |
Manual event monitoring | Difficult with large-scale infrastructure |
Separate security solutions | Reduces centralized visibility |
Reactive investigation | Slows response to emerging threats |
ICT organizations require a security model that combines technology monitoring with expert analysis.
How ICT Threat Detection Solutions Work Through Managed SOC
A managed SOC service provides structured monitoring through security technology and professional expertise.
Centralized Security Monitoring
SOC teams collect security information from networks, servers, cloud systems, and applications. This creates a unified view of potential security events.
Managed SIEM Analysis
Managed SIEM platforms analyze security data from different sources. This helps identify unusual activities and supports efficient investigation.
Threat Identification
Security analysts review alerts and investigate suspicious activities to determine potential security concerns.
Response Support
When threats are confirmed, SOC teams provide investigation support and help organizations coordinate response actions.

Best Practices for ICT Security Management
Organizations can strengthen security operations by implementing these practices:
- Identify critical infrastructure assets
- Monitor administrative activities
- Establish incident response procedures
- Review security insights regularly
- Conduct cybersecurity awareness training
- Assess risks from new technologies
These steps help ICT companies develop a stronger cybersecurity approach.
